Management of Persistent, Post-adenotonsillectomy Obstructive Sleep Apnea in Children: An Official American Thoracic

Insights

Persistent obstructive sleep apnea (OSA) in children requires further management after initial surgery. This guideline offers evidence-based recommendations for clinicians treating children with ongoing pediatric OSA.

Background:

  • Obstructive sleep apnea (OSA) is a prevalent sleep disorder in children.
  • Adenotonsillectomy is the primary treatment, but up to 40% of pediatric cases persist.
  • This guideline addresses the management of persistent pediatric OSA.

Purpose of the Study:

  • To provide an evidence-based clinical practice guideline for managing persistent pediatric obstructive sleep apnea (OSA).
  • To guide clinicians, including physicians, dentists, and allied health professionals, in treating children with persistent OSA.

Main Methods:

  • A multidisciplinary international expert panel convened to address key questions.
  • Systematic literature review was conducted using the Grading of Recommendations, Assessment, Development, and Evaluation (GRADE) approach.
  • Recommendations considered evidence quality, benefits, risks, patient values, cost, and feasibility.

Main Results:

  • Six distinct management options for persistent pediatric OSA were evaluated.
  • Evidence-based recommendations were formulated for each management strategy.

Conclusions:

  • The guideline provides recommendations for persistent pediatric OSA management, acknowledging limited evidence and relying on expert consensus.
  • Future research priorities were identified for each recommendation to advance the field.

Sleep Apnea

Sleep apnea is a condition where breathing stops intermittently during sleep, often leading to significant health issues. Each episode can last from 10 to 20 seconds or more and is frequently accompanied by a brief arousal from sleep. This disturbance, largely unnoticed by the individual, can lead to severe daytime fatigue. Commonly, individuals seek help after being informed by their partners about loud snoring and noticeable breathing pauses during sleep.

Chronic Pharyngitis

Chronic pharyngitis refers to persistent inflammation of the pharyngial mucosa.
Etiology
It often arises from persistent viral or bacterial infections affecting sinuses and tonsils.
Additional contributing factors include inadequate dental hygiene, mouth breathing, recurring tonsillitis, allergic rhinitis, laryngopharyngeal reflux, and exposure to smoke, chemicals, and other environmental pollutants.
